Tim sent out an S.O.S early in the week as there was a distinct lack of availability & the propsect of not playing, therefore being docked 20 points was troubling. St.John's Billericay were below us in the table & would overtake us if they were awarded the win.
The limited numbers slowly crept up, but included a few maybe players, so would the game go ahead? Finally, late in the week, Tim had a team & there was some quality within this bunch of players too.
Jack was captain & failed in his first duty, St.John's Billericay winning the toss & choosing to bat on the hottest cricket day of the season. The openers did well, both scoring decent totals & it took Snail & Jack to take their wickets. Both finished with 2 wickets each. John D also bagged 2 wickets. Danny had great figures, but no wickets. Goochie & Nick took a catch each, and Sam took a stumping. Goochie also managed a run out, imagine being run out by Goochie!!!
St.John's Billericay ended up with 204 for 7, which was a great effort by the 3s.
John D got started, but did not manage to push on, Regan & Nick fell cheaply & Snail & Jack were left to put us in with a chance. Jack got to 30 & Snail got the inevitable 50, before both were out. Danny scored 20, further demonstrating his ability low down the order.
But, the task proved too much for the 3s heroes & St.John's Billericay won by 24 runs.
Well done to all who helped out & the whole team for such a great effort. This should mean that the 3s stay up, providing the last 3 cricket weekends give us the opportunity to get some points.
